Overview
- Eco Wave Power said it delivered a final completion report to Shell, closing all objectives and milestones for the AltaSea pilot at the Port of Los Angeles.
- The partnership moved from a U.S. coastline study that flagged 77 promising sites to permitting, design, installation, and real-world operation at the port.
- The company says the project obtained required permits and approvals, and environmental reviews under NEPA and CEQA found no significant impact.
- The onshore setup attached to existing structures avoided seabed anchoring, offshore construction, and subsea cabling, and the firm reports total pilot cost stayed under $1 million.
- The AltaSea unit will keep running as a demonstration site for policymakers and potential partners, serving as a reference for future commercial projects at ports and breakwaters.
